Looking at that closely, the whole corner has been seperated ( hence the wood screw )
I would have started by taking that out and slightly open the joint then lots of wood glue and clamp for a few days.
After dry, I would have tried to build up the rest with epoxy or fiberglass making a mold to hold it in place. Then a rough sanding building up again if needed to make level.
I would have finished off with green glazing or spot puddy to get out any imperfections. Lots of sanding and eyeball work to make perfect.
Mask off artwork and spray with primer and flat black fading into the original.
